Who Actually Uses XRP? Separating Reality From Narrative

Source Beincrypto

Few cryptocurrencies are as polarizing as XRP. Critics across the crypto and DeFi ecosystem often claim XRP has no real utility. They argue it exists mainly as a speculative asset with limited real-world use. 

At the same time, XRP maintains one of the largest and most vocal communities in crypto – The XRP Army. They believe the altcoin will eventually power global financial infrastructure.

The truth sits somewhere between those two extremes. XRP does have real utility, but its usage is more specific and narrower than many assume.

XRP is More Unique Than Any Other Cryptocurrency

XRP is the native token of the XRP Ledger, launched in 2012 with a clear purpose: enabling fast and efficient cross-border payments. 

Unlike Bitcoin, which focuses on decentralized value storage, or Ethereum, which focuses on programmable smart contracts, XRP was designed primarily to move money between financial systems quickly and cheaply.

Transactions on the XRP Ledger settle in about three to five seconds and cost a fraction of a cent. This makes XRP particularly efficient as a bridge currency, allowing instant conversion between two different fiat currencies without requiring banks or payment providers to hold large reserves in foreign accounts.

Millions Hold XRP — But Most Usage Comes From Traders and Infrastructure

Retail investors make up the largest group of XRP users today. As of early 2025, the XRP Ledger had roughly 6 to 7 million funded accounts, which represent wallets holding XRP. 

After adjusting for exchange custody and users holding multiple wallets, analysts estimate around 2 to 3 million individuals globally actually hold XRP.

Crypto exchanges are another major user. Platforms such as Binance, Bitstamp, Kraken, and Uphold use XRP for liquidity management and transfers. 

XRP’s speed and low cost make it an efficient tool for moving funds between exchanges and managing trading liquidity.

Payment providers also represent a key real-world use case. Companies like SBI Remit in Japan and Tranglo in Southeast Asia use XRP through Ripple’s On-Demand Liquidity system to facilitate international remittances. 

In these cases, XRP acts as a temporary bridge asset, allowing money to move across borders instantly without pre-funded foreign accounts.

Banks Use Ripple Technology, But Only Select Partners Actually Use XRP

Banks, however, present a more nuanced picture. Major financial institutions including Santander, Standard Chartered, and Bank of America have used Ripple’s payment infrastructure. 

But most of them use Ripple’s messaging and settlement software without directly using XRP itself. Only select payment providers, rather than global banks broadly, use XRP directly for liquidity.

Beyond financial transfers, XRP also plays an essential technical role within its own network. Every XRP Ledger account must hold XRP, and all transactions require XRP to pay network fees. 

XRP supports decentralized trading, token issuance, and asset transfers on the ledger.

So, XRP is neither useless nor universally adopted. Its utility exists in specific financial infrastructure roles, particularly in liquidity provisioning and payment settlement. 

Understanding who actually uses XRP reveals a clearer picture—one grounded in real-world function rather than speculation.
